Output 76c394d0899b7b7a1fc62ddb9196c2de5caf27458fe3da1aaf67bb1d4e060dfa:2

value
1636952
script pubkey
OP_0 OP_PUSHBYTES_20 2d320c5efeb1c86b0aeed9d9338e57950dabe986
address
bc1q95eqchh7k8yxkzhwm8vn8rjhj5x6h6vx3el7u9
transaction
76c394d0899b7b7a1fc62ddb9196c2de5caf27458fe3da1aaf67bb1d4e060dfa
spent
true